Bug#875982: RM: obsolete with current Perl?

2017-09-16 Thread Florian Schlichting
Package: libsub-current-perl Version: 0.03-2 Severity: serious Justification: obsolete with perl >= 5.16.0 libsub-current-perl 0.03 added a note to its POD explaining that from perl 5.16.0, the built-in __SUB__ can be used instead via the pragma use feature 'current_sub';

Bug#875963: python-azure: ships /usr/lib/python2.7/dist-packages/tests/__init__.py

2017-09-16 Thread Andreas Beckmann
Package: python-azure Version: 20170915+git-1 Severity: serious User: debian...@lists.debian.org Usertags: piuparts Hi, /usr/lib/python2.7/dist-packages/test/__init__.py is a way too generic name that shouldn't be used by any python module, since it can easily lead to file conflicts between
